Better Balance
Instructor: David Curtis
You will learn to improve core stability and strength, as well as static balance and balance while in motion, through the practice of seated and standing weighted exercises. Join David on a quick training session where you will improve your strength, coordination and balance.

Parkinson’s Dance (Sponsored by MAPS)
Instructor: Lynn Rosen Stone
Our Parkinson’s Dance class will give people living with Parkinson’s the opportunity to explore fun movements, engaging music and a social environment. Dancers will learn movements from modern dance, folk, tap, social dancing and more.

Rock Steady Boxing (Sponsored by MAPS)
Instructor: Markese Hayden
Rock Steady Boxing gives people with Parkinson’s disease hope by improving their quality of life through a non-contact, boxing-based fitness curriculum. Boxers condition for optimal agility, speed, muscular endurance, accuracy, balance, hand-eye coordination, footwork and overall strength to defend against and overcome opponents.
